What You'll Do

Reporting directly to the Fleet Manager, the Fleet Asset Administrator plays a key role in ensuring that all equipment activity across projects is accurately tracked, verified, and translated into reliable data for billing and operational decision-making. It involves gathering information from multiple sources, cross-checking it for accuracy, and resolving any inconsistencies by working closely with field teams and internal stakeholders.

The position also focuses on turning raw data into meaningful insights by analyzing utilization patterns, identifying inefficiencies, and highlighting trends that impact performance and cost. In addition, it supports the billing process by applying company standards to equipment usage, ensuring that all reported hours are consistent, justified, and ready for invoicing.


Key Responsibilities

The responsibilities include, but may not be limited to:

- Compile, analyze, and validate equipment utilization, and performance data from timesheets, GPS systems, and internal platforms across active projects

- Collaborate with Site Leads, Foremen, Equipment Coordinators, and Project Managers to confirm accuracy of reported usage

- Maintain accurate and consistent asset tracking records, ensuring completeness and data integrity

- Investigate and resolve discrepancies between reported, actual, and expected usage through reconciliation and follow-up

- Apply company billing rules (e.g., daily maximums, equipment limits) to standardize and adjust hours for accurate billing

- Prepare structured, validated data to support billing and Accounts Receivable processes

- Produce regular and ad hoc reports on utilization trends, downtime, inefficiencies, and cost impacts

- Track outstanding verifications and follow up with site teams to ensure timely and accurate data submission

- Work cross-functionally with Fleet, Project Controls, Operations, Procurement, and Accounting to ensure alignment and data accuracy

- Contribute to continuous improvement of tracking systems, reconciliation processes, and overall data quality
